N.J. Stat. § 2A:156A-19: Unlawful use, disclosure, third degree crime

19. Except as specifically authorized pursuant to this act any person who knowingly uses or discloses the existence of an order authorizing interception of a wire, electronic or oral communication or the contents of, or information concerning, an intercepted wire, electronic or oral communication or evidence derived therefrom, is guilty of a crime of the third degree.

L.1968,c.409,s.19; amended 1989,c 85,s.5; 1993,c.29,s.17.
